命令 59:获取加减速度表格注册值

分区获取直线动作和CP动作的加减速度的当前设定值。

获取加速度和减速度。

命令格式

bit 名称 说明
参数1 15 表格编号 以0 — 15的整数指定表格的注册位置
14
1
0

响应格式

bit 名称 说明
响应1 15 表格编号 返回指定的表格编号
14
1
0
bit 名称 说明
响应2 15

加速设定值

高位字

将加速度的实数值(单位:mm/sec2)扩大1000倍,转换为32位整数后进行设置

高16位

14
1
0
bit 名称 说明
响应3 15

加速设定值

低位字

将加速度的实数值(单位:mm/sec2)扩大1000倍,转换为32位整数后进行设置

低16位

14
1
0
bit 名称 说明
响应4 15

减速设定值

高位字

将减速度的实数值(单位:mm/sec2)扩大1000倍,转换为32位整数后进行设置

高16位

14
1
0
bit 名称 说明
响应5 15

减速设定值

低位字

将减速度的实数值(单位:mm/sec2)扩大1000倍,转换为32位整数后进行设置

低16位

14
1
0

说明

从直线动作和CP动作的加减速度表格的指定位置获取注册值。

通过该命令可以同时获取加速度、减速度。

指定范围外的表格编号或指定编号的表格未注册时,返回异常响应。

设定值以小数点后3位有效的固定小数点数据的形式返回。

使用示例

注册加速设定值100.123、减速设定值200.000到表格15

命令 响应
003BH 000FH 003BH 000FH 0001H 871BH 0003H 0D40H